We are looking for a highly organised and detail-focused Property Finance Assistant to support the smooth running of property, finance and operational administration. This role would suit someone with experience in property finance, facilities, real estate, accounts administration or general finance support. You will be responsible for processing invoices and payment requests, maintaining accurate records, supporting budget monitoring and liaising with suppliers, contractors and internal teams.
Key Responsibilities
- Review, code and process invoices, purchase orders and payment requests using systems such as Workday, SAP Concur, Proactis, DocuSign and Halo.
- Assist with budgets, financial reporting, reconciliations and monitoring project expenditure and budget variances.
- Maintain accurate property, lease, supplier, contract, asset and vehicle records across internal systems and databases.
- Coordinate supplier onboarding and manage supplier queries relating to invoices, quotations, contracts and payments.
- Support the administration of contracts, leases, service charges, council tax, utility bills, reserve funds and property compliance documentation.
- Maintain Planned Preventative Maintenance records and ensure filing systems remain accurate, compliant and up to date.
- Liaise with internal departments, contractors, suppliers and external stakeholders regarding property and operational matters.
- Provide administrative support across property operations, projects and general finance activities.
- Support colleagues during absences and undertake additional duties within the scope of the role.
